A Prospective Randomize Study: Prevention of Nausea and Vomiting in Plastic Surgery
We designed this randomized, double- blind, single-center study to compare the efficacy of the combination of dexamethasone with ondansetron and dexamethasone with dimenhydrinate undergoing plastic surgery.

Primary outcomes
- prevention of postoperative nausea and vomiting — 1 year
The primary outcome is complete response: complete response is defined as no postoperative nausea (VRS≤3), retching or vomiting and no need for rescue antiemetic.
